The first match played on Ibrox Park sine the disaster on April 5 took place last night, when the home team opposed the Hibernian in a friendly game. There was a poor attendance. Hibs won the toss and with a strong sun in their eyes Rangers kicked off. Rennie was early called upon to clear a long shot, and at the other end Dickie was equally successful. A corner for the strangers proved abortive, mainly through an effective clearance by Neil. The wet grass proved trying to both teams, and miss kicks were frequent. Though with a weakened team Hibs forced the game, and the combination of Day and McGinnes brought the Eastern eleven the first goal. Well out on the wing Day shot in and Dickie scarped clear. The ball however came to Buchan, and the outside left man had no difficulty in sending into the net. At the other end Rangers pressed for some time and a surprise shot by Graham equalised the score. Close on halftime Atherton by a brilliant individual effort scored a second goal, and a couple of minutes later Buchan registered a third. Halftime – Hibs 3 goal: Rangers 1. Rangers began the second half with vim, but it was not long before the Hibs retaliated in kind, and the scene of operations was around Dickie. Play ranged from end to end, Rennie had to deal with a corner kick, and the next minute Dickie was busy. He weakly cleared, and Buchan made the Hibernian total 4. Though 3 goals to the bad, Rangers showed no diminution of effort, and they pegged away, but were decidedly unfortunate in front of Rennie. Towards the finish of the game the play was equally divided. Result – Hibernian 4 goals: Rangers 1
